Transaction e492589ccc06d4e42b9cfcfed2868266d9776f1c38fe793b56051836e675c4a7
1 Input
1 Output
-
e492589ccc06d4e42b9cfcfed2868266d9776f1c38fe793b56051836e675c4a7:0
- value
- 57763
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d44d33e07d8a2630a8f612599afde0d345543bdb OP_EQUAL
- address
- 3M3ZfLzir8Yk7Y9EUdB8JNSEqXTHEDvjGR